On Mar 11 2016, Thewordygecko said:
A truly life-changing reading experience, Berger's writing is beautiful in its poetry and humanity, and Mohr's photographs revealing and earthy. One of my favourite books, it does have special resonances for those who have anything to do with the treatment of ill people, or who have been ill themselves. Outstanding book in an exceptionally good body of work by Berger and Mohr.
